ORDER : The Court Made the following order :- The Criminal Miscellaneous Petition has been filed seeking orders to modify the condition imposed on the petitioner by this Court in its order, dated 04.04.2025, made in Crl.M.P(MD)No.1900 of 2024 in Crl.A(MD)No.130 of 2024, directing the petitioner to produce two sureties, who are respectable persons in the society, in order to ensure the conduct and the availability of the petitioner during the appeal proceedings.
2. Heard the learned counsel appearing for the petitioner and the learned Government Advocate (Criminal Side) appearing for the State.
3. The learned counsel appearing for the petitioner would submit that the petitioner has produced the sureties including the Corporation Employee, but the learned trial Judge has returned the same saying that they are not respectable person. He would further submit that the petitioner's mother and sister are ready to stand as sureties for the petitioner.
2/4
4. Considering the above, the condition imposed on the petitioner to produce two sureties, who are respectable persons in the society, is modified to the effect that the petitioner is directed to produce two blood sureties to the satisfaction of the concerned Court and they have to file an affidavit to ensure the availability of the petitioner during the appeal proceedings.
5. With the above modification, this Criminal Miscellaneous Petition is disposed of.
